New contacts with decision-makers, global business opportunities and worldwide streams of visitors: Heimtextil 2024 ended with 46,000 visitors[1] from around 130 nations and 2,838 exhibitors from 60 nations with 25 per cent growth. With a plus in visitors, the show overcame difficult travel conditions due to nationwide rail strikes and regional demonstrations. The response from international buyers to the quality and variety of the new Carpets & Rugs product segment was overwhelming. With over 2,800 exhibitors from 60 countries and a 95-percent level of internationality, this year’s Heimtextil continues to grow. At a panel discussion during the opening press conference, the leading trade fair for home and contract textiles put the spotlight on the significance of artificial intel-ligence (AI). How is AI speeding up the design process? Which tried and tested pro-cesses have already been introduced in the home textiles sector? What measures are necessary to prevent copyright infringements?
